WILL YOU ANSWER THE CALL AND HELP YOUR COMMUNITY?
Every day in cities, towns and rural communities throughout our region, volunteers respond to emergency calls for firefighters, ambulance drivers, emergency medical technicians and disaster relief personnel. These dedicated men and women are our first line of defense in natural and man-made disasters. The problem is numbers. The number of volunteers has not kept up with the growth in population and the subsequent need for more emergency personnel.

To help recruit new volunteers a toll-free number 1-800-FIRE LINE has been established to match those interested in serving their community with their closest emergency service organization. If you're interested in helping your community, please make the call.
